Medicare
For the first 20 days of a eligible nursing home stay, Medicare will pay for the entire bill and a substantial percentage of the covered charges until day 100. After that, Medicare will not cover any {portion|part|segment} of the cost. While this is sufficient for short-term care, those who need long-term care must either finance themselves or seek economic support from different avenues.

Medicaid
For those who qualify, Medicaid covers the cost for skilled nursing care when Medicare ceases coverage after 100 days. In addition, it pays for the expenses of living in an authorized nursing home. However, because Medicaid entitlement requirements are rigorous and complicated, not all elderly individuals are qualified for benefits.
Veterans Benefits
Veterans receiving a VA pension may be qualified for the VA's Aid and Attendance benefits. VA Aid and Attendance is a monthly stipend that veterans and their spouses can use to pay for long-term care, such as skilled nursing care.
